Output e3bab46ce7ab9efbbdd22f07a30fe4c3d18cf18c6e9aea5dcbb75ef241615a68:1

value
78233838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54574c03c1a0b231e9cfde8d1003ed894460185 OP_EQUAL
address
3M8h4J5BxWQCutj8pdWHMTKGE9c3stqVN3
transaction
e3bab46ce7ab9efbbdd22f07a30fe4c3d18cf18c6e9aea5dcbb75ef241615a68
confirmations
518013
spent
true